What does the C scale in hardness testing represent?

Study for the Leaving Certificate Engineering Exam. Enhance your knowledge with quizzes and questions featuring hints and detailed explanations. Prepare effectively for success in your exam!

The C scale in hardness testing, specifically in the Rockwell hardness test, signifies the use of a diamond indenter for determining hardness. The diamond indenter is necessary for testing harder materials, as it can penetrate and ensure accurate readings without deformation from softer materials. This scale measures the depth of penetration under a large load compared to a minor load, providing a measure of hardness that is particularly suited for harder materials such as hardened steel.
